Civil Rights Commission subcommittees

The Civil Rights Commission has three subcommittees that help organize its work.

Community Engagement & Research Subcommittee

The Community Engagement & Research Subcommittee:

  • Educates the public on the work of the commission, civil rights protections, and the complaint filing process
  • Hosts public forums
  • Researches civil rights issues facing the City
  • Develops civil rights policy recommendations

Meeting details

This subcommittee typically meets the 3rd Monday of the month at 5:00 p.m.

Standards & Procedures Subcommittee

The Standards & Procedures Subcommittee monitors and revises rules and procedures of the commission.

Meeting details

This subcommittee meets as needed.

Workforce & Contract Compliance Subcommittee

The Workforce & Contract Compliance Subcommittee:

  • Researches civil rights issues and recommends policies related to employment, contracts and grant-making
  • Works with the Contract Compliance division of the Department of Civil Rights on policy and review panels
  • Encourages minority and women-owned businesses to contract with the City

Meeting details

This subcommittee typically meets the 3rd Monday of the month at 5:00 p.m.
